The Postgraduate Certificate in Pottery Wheel Mugs Firing is a specialized program designed to enhance skills in ceramic art, focusing on the creation and firing of mugs using a pottery wheel. Students will master advanced techniques in shaping, glazing, and kiln firing, ensuring high-quality, functional pottery pieces.
The program typically spans 6 to 12 months, offering a blend of hands-on studio practice and theoretical knowledge. This duration allows learners to develop a deep understanding of clay properties, wheel-throwing methods, and firing processes, including oxidation and reduction techniques.
Key learning outcomes include proficiency in designing unique mug forms, applying decorative finishes, and troubleshooting common firing issues. Graduates will also gain expertise in maintaining pottery equipment and understanding safety protocols in studio environments.
